Our full training programme is made up of one 60-minute module and meets once online. 

Module 1. Introducing Strengths-Based Strategies for Challenging Behaviours

• Redefining “challenging” behaviours 
• Connecting authentically with young people/rangatahi 
• Clarifying desired behaviours early on 
• Creating cultures that care 
• Processes for healing mistakes 
• Negotiating consequences rather than punishment 
• Having more fun than friction.
